Tasting Notes
Colour
pale gold (amazingly light)
air Nose
no, wait, it’s a little tired, perhaps a notch too metallic and cardboardy, and certainly lacking fruits and spices. Hello? Someone in there? We’re actually nosing damp earth, or wandering throughout caves or even catacombs. Scary, isn’t it
restaurant Palate
better, but it’s not one of the best. Rather too herbal and grassy, cardboardy, and simply tired. On the other hand, there are many oils and liqueurs that came straight from the wood, including myrtle, citron, ginger, eucalyptus, balsam…
timer Finish
rather short, and too woody. You have to enjoy herbal things! Bitterish aftertaste
